Chicago 2 Bedroom Apartment Units with Current Availability by Neighborhood

Availability Confirmed As of: August 23, 2025

There are currently 17820 available 2 Bedroom apartment units from neighborhoods all over Chicago, IL that range in price from $600 to $27,256. North Lakefront, Northwest Chicago and Southwest Chicago are the neighborhoods that currently have the most 2 Bedroom availability. Here is today's list of the top neighborhoods in Chicago with the most available 2 Bedroom apartments:

Cheapest Available Chicago 2 Bedroom Apartments

As of August 23, 2025 the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Chicago, IL is the 2 Bedroom 1 Bath Apartment Model starting from $885 at 1108 E 82nd St in the Chatham neighborhood. The second most affordable Chicago 2 Bedroom is the Two Bedroom 50% AMI Model at Boxelder Court starting at $965 in the Washington Park neighborhood.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Chicago is currently $3,202.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in Chicago:

Chicago Overview

Chicago is one of the largest and liveliest cities in the United States with a thriving economy, an active nightlife and some of the world's most historic buildings and landmarks making it a very popular place to call home. The school system and metropolitan offerings make Chicago one of the best places to live in the Midwest in addition to being a premiere tourist destination. The options for cheap apartments in Chicago as well as rental homes, condos, and townhomes in the area make it a renters dream come true.

Why live in Chicago, IL?

With its numerous shops and local cuisine, a bustling nightlife, a strong economy and an efficient if busy transportation system, Chicago is truly the gem of the Midwest. While school districts vary from one area to the next, Chicago is a hub for some of the world's best schools, universities and hospitals, making it an ideal place to settle down. As home to some of the leading universities in the world, Chicago offers plenty of opportunities for its residents to grow up, get an education and find work in its diverse and thriving economy.
